Содержание
Мечтаете запустить своё приложение в Google Play или сменить профессию на одну из самых востребованных в IT? Первый шаг — понять, что вас ждет в реальности. Путь в Android-разработку можно начать с разных точек: самостоятельным блужданием по статьям, университетской программой или, что часто эффективнее, через структурированные курсы андроид разработчика с нуля, которые, как программа на Eduson Academy, проводят вас от азов до готового портфолио. Давайте без розовых очков и сложных терминов разберем главные вопросы.
Сколько времени уйдет на обучение и какая ждет зарплата?
Давайте сразу отбросим истории про «стану программистом за месяц». Чтобы уверенно писать код и претендовать на первую работу или создать рабочее приложение, готовьтесь инвестировать от 8 месяцев до полутора лет. Это при условии регулярных занятий (15-20 часов в неделю).
Как это время распределяется:
-
Азы (2-4 месяца): Учим язык (сейчас это в основном Kotlin — он понятнее Java). Это как изучение алфавита и грамматики перед написанием книг.
-
Знакомство с платформой (3-6 месяцев): Разбираемся, как устроено любое Android-приложение: экраны, кнопки, навигация, как все это «живет» и взаимодействует.
-
Работа с «мозгами» приложения (1-2 месяца): Как сохранять данные в телефон (заметки, настройки), как загружать что-то из интернета (ленту новостей, товары).
-
Переход на профессиональный уровень (2-3 месяца): Учимся писать не просто рабочий, а красивый, гибкий и надежный код, который потом не придется полностью переделывать. Осваиваем Git — систему контроля версий (это как «машина времени» для кода).
Главный совет: с первого дня параллельно с теорией делайте свои маленькие проекты. Без практики вся теория выветривается.
А что со спросом и зарплатами? Здесь новичков ждут хорошие новости. Android-разработчики стабильно входят в топ-10 самых нужных IT-специалистов. Спрос есть и в крупных продуктовых компаниях (банки, маркетплейсы, соцсети), и в стартапах, и в аутсорсе. С появлением умных устройств (часы, телевизоры, автомобили) на Android, спрос только растет.
Зарплата напрямую зависит от вашего уровня и города (или возможности работать на зарубежный рынок удаленно). Вот ориентировочная картина по рынку на 2024-2025 годы:
Уровни, обязанности и доход Android-разработчика
Junior (Джуниор)
-
Опыт: 0 – 1,5 года.
-
Что обычно умеет и делает: Пишет код по готовым задачам под присмотром. Создает простые экраны, чинит мелкие баги. Основное занятие — активное обучение.
-
Вилка зарплаты (в месяц): 70 000 – 120 000 руб.
Middle (Миддл)
-
Опыт: 1,5 – 3+ года.
-
Что обычно умеет и делает: Самостоятельно ведет feature (фичу) от начала до конца. Хорошо знает Kotlin, архитектуру (например, MVVM), основные библиотеки. Может помогать джуниорам.
-
Вилка зарплаты (в месяц): 120 000 – 250 000 руб.
Senior (Сеньор)
-
Опыт: 4+ года.
-
Что обычно умеет и делает: Отвечает за архитектуру целого модуля или проекта. Принимает ключевые технические решения. Участвует в планировании и наставничестве. Решает наиболее сложные задачи.
-
Вилка зарплаты (в месяц): 220 000 – 400 000+ руб.
Примечание:
Зарплаты в Москве и на удаленных позициях в зарубежных компаниях (в долларах/евро) могут быть на 20-50% выше. Уровень определяется не столько стажем, сколько реальными навыками и сложностью решенных задач.
Это сложно? Легко ли войти в профессию?
Скажем так: это сложно, но абсолютно реально. Это не магия, а ремесло. Сложность — как в освоении любого серьезного ремесла: нужно понять логику, набить руку и не бояться гуглить.
С какими трудностями столкнется новичок:
-
Информационная перегрузка. Технологий, библиотек и подходов очень много. Важно не хвататься за всё, а идти по четкому плану.
-
Не все работает с первого раза. Ошибки (баги) — это нормально и даже полезно. 80% времени разработчик не пишет новый код, а ищет, почему не работает существующий.
-
Нужно думать «как пользователь». Приложение должно работать быстро даже на старом телефоне и не «кушать» всю батарею.
Но хорошая новость в том, что сообщество Android-разработчиков огромное, а инструменты (как среда Android Studio) становятся все дружелюбнее. Если вам нравится решать головоломки и видеть осязаемый результат своей работы — вы справитесь.
Если я хочу сделать своё приложение? Сколько это стоит?
Здесь два принципиально разных пути: делать самому или нанять команду. Стоимость — самый «плавающий» параметр. Вот три основных способа достичь цели:
1. Заказать у фрилансера
-
Сроки (приложение средней сложности): 2 — 5 месяцев.
-
Ориентировочная стоимость (2024-2025): От 300 000 ₽ до 1 500 000 ₽ и выше.
-
Плюсы и минусы: Плюс: Быстрый старт. Минус: Риск неоднородного качества, сложность долгой поддержки и внесения правок.
2. Нанять студию (аутсорс)
-
Сроки (приложение средней сложности): 3 — 6 месяцев.
-
Ориентировочная стоимость (2024-2025): От 1 500 000 ₽ до 5 000 000 ₽ и выше.
-
Плюсы и минусы: Плюс: Работа с командой профессионалов (аналитик, дизайнер, разработчики, тестировщик), комплексный подход и гарантия результата. Минус: Максимально дорого.
3. Научиться и сделать самому
-
Сроки: 1+ год обучения + 3-6 месяцев непосредственной разработки.
-
Ориентировочная стоимость: В основном стоимость вашего времени, а также курсов и, возможно, оплаты дизайнеру для макета (примерно от 30 000 ₽).
-
Плюсы и минусы: Плюс: Полный контроль над продуктом, бесценный опыт, экономия денег в долгосрочной перспективе. Минус: Очень много времени и сил, высокий риск забросить проект..
Что будет с ценами, зарплатами и трендами в 2026 году?
Давайте заглянем в ближайшее будущее. К 2026 году создание приложений, скорее всего, не подешевеет, а станет еще сложнее в технологическом плане. Вот на что стоит обратить внимание:
-
Спрос на разработчиков останется высоким, но сместится в сторону более квалифицированных кадров. Простых «кодеров» будут заменять Low-Code платформы для базовых задач, а вот за сильных мидлов и сеньоров, которые умеют работать с AI, безопасностью и сложной архитектурой, конкуренция (и, соответственно, зарплаты) будут только расти.
-
AI будет везде. Ожидается, что умные помощники внутри приложений, нейросети для обработки фото/текста станут почти стандартом. Их внедрение увеличит бюджет проекта, но и поднимет планку для разработчиков — эти навыки будут цениться на вес золота.
-
Требования к качеству и безопасности растут. Пользователи привыкли к топовым приложениям. «Сырой» продукт с плохим дизайном просто не выживет. Защита данных — обязательный пункт.
Прогноз: Если сегодня типовое бизнес-приложение стоит около 2 млн ₽, то к 2026 аналогичный проект, но уже с парой «фишек» на базе AI и повышенными требованиями к UX/безопасности, может оцениваться уже в 2.5 — 3 млн ₽. При этом зарплата опытного (middle+) разработчика к 2026 может вырасти на 15-25% относительно сегодняшних цифр, особенно для специалистов, работающих с иностранными заказчиками или в высокотехнологичных нишах.
И что в итоге?
Android-разработка — это долгая, но увлекательная дорога с четкими правилами и отличными финансовыми перспективами. Не ждите мгновенных результатов. Если хотите в профессию — настройтесь на год упорного обучения, но с пониманием, что вложения окупятся стабильным спросом и хорошим доходом. Если хотите приложение для бизнеса — готовьте серьезный бюджет или выделяйте время, чтобы погрузиться в тему самому.
Начинайте с маленькой, но рабочей версии вашей идеи (MVP), тестируйте её на реальных пользователях и постепенно развивайте. И помните, что самый надежный актив в этом деле — не гениальная идея, а ваши собственные знания и навыки, которые позволят вам эту идею контролировать, менять под запросы рынка и строить успешную карьеру в одной из самых динамичных сфер IT.